Condo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a bathroom or kitchen Yes No DIY fixes are usually simple and inexpensive.
Water damage in a large area or multiple rooms No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are needed to dry large areas quickly and safely.
Visible mold or mildew growth No Yes Mold and mildew need specialized cleaning and remediation to prevent health problems.
High-rise condo with extensive water damage No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are needed to safely access and repair high-rise condos.
Water damage from a natural disaster (e.g. Flood, hurricane) No Yes Professional help is essential to quickly and safely restore your condo after a natural disaster.
Water damage in a condo with unique or custom features No Yes Professional expertise is needed to safely and effectively repair unique or custom features.

Condo Water Extraction Cost in Allen, TX

The cost of Condo Water Extraction in Allen, TX can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are based on the following factors: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ment needed
Cleaning and S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of cleaning products needed
Restoration and Repairs $1,000 – $5,000 Scope of repairs, materials needed, labor costs
Emergency Response and Assessment $100 – $500 Time of day, distance to travel, complexity of the job
Disinfection and Dehumidification $300 – $1,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Debris Removal and Disposal $100 – $500 Amount of debris, disposal costs

Common Questions About Condo Water Extraction

Q: How long does it take to dry a condo after water damage?

A: The drying time depends on the size of the affected area, the severity of the damage, and the type of equipment used. Our team will work with you to find out the best drying strategy and provide a timeline for completion.

Q: Do I need to replace my carpet after water damage?

A: It depends on the extent of the damage and the type of carpet. In some cases, we can clean and restore the carpet, while in others, replacement may be necessary. Our team will assess the damage and provide a recommendation.

Q: Can I use bleach to clean my condo after water damage?

A: No, bleach is not recommended for cleaning water-damaged condos. Bleach can damage surfaces, discolor materials, and create health hazards. Our team will use eco-friendly cleaning products to ensure a safe and healthy environment.

Q: How do I prevent water damage in my condo?

A: Regular maintenance is key to preventing water damage. Check your condo’s roof, gutters, and downspouts regularly, and address any issues quickly. Our team can also provide recommendations for preventive measures and regular inspections.
